Ruby wants to get busy with work, but can’t because of Arima‘a schedule. Aqua is thoroughly impressed by the stage around theatre. He learns it’s another work of Raida and GOA. Which makes him understand that Abiko wouldn’t be able to pull off a script suitable for this theatre setup. He understands that the problem lies in miscommunication.

Aqua and the other cast meet Kichijouji to help reason with Abiko. But I can understand all her concerns and how she wants to draw a line to not interfere with others’ works.

Kichijouji went to meet Abiko and damn, they started bashing each other with words. Shouting and teasing and dissing, that was funny. In the end, she gave Abiko the ticket Aqua gave, hoping it would change her mind.

I really love the dynamic between Yoriko and Abiko, and I appreciate Aqua's observations regarding the whole rewrite debacle. Only Yoriko could console Abiko due to their mentor/student relationship, working the exact same industry, experienced the exact same hardships, worked on the exact same manga serializations, and know each other well, both in terms of each other's works and as individuals. I love how Yoriko immediately recognized the reasons behind Abiko's horrid living conditions, her state of mind, and the inevitable end result of her current lifestyle. Not only that, I love how Yoriko initially starts by speaking out of a place of stern concern, forcing her way into Abiko's work studio and speaking purely out of experience. When Akibo responded in hostility, criticizing Yoriko's success, I wasn't sure what to expect, but I loved how she fired back, criticizing how Akibo's writing succumbed to readership opinions rather than keeping with her original vision. I could watch a whole episode on their back and forth banter. They're both professional mangaka and can trash talk each other fluently in the language of mangaka. The difference is Yoriko truly does have more experience, both as a person and as a professional, so Akibo had to relent.

Regardless of the profession, I'm always fascinated to listen to people talk passionately about what they love. It's interesting to hear how they live their lives, and why they continue doing the things they do. Oshi no Ko continues to be interesting in this regard, as it features more and more different people in different segments of their respective entertainment media.
